数据库 · 5 11 月, 2024

快速入門:如何建立單機數據庫 (建立單機數據庫)

快速入門:如何建立單機數據庫

在當今數據驅動的世界中,數據庫的使用變得越來越普遍。無論是開發應用程序、網站還是進行數據分析,建立一個單機數據庫都是一個重要的步驟。本文將指導您如何在本地環境中建立一個單機數據庫,並提供一些實用的示例和代碼片段。

什麼是單機數據庫?

單機數據庫是指在單一計算機上運行的數據庫系統。與分佈式數據庫不同,單機數據庫的所有數據和操作都在本地進行,這使得它在開發和測試階段特別有用。常見的單機數據庫系統包括 SQLite、MySQL 和 PostgreSQL。

選擇數據庫管理系統

在建立單機數據庫之前,首先需要選擇合適的數據庫管理系統(DBMS)。以下是幾個流行的選擇:

  • SQLite:輕量級的數據庫,適合小型應用和嵌入式系統。
  • MySQL:功能強大的開源數據庫,適合中大型應用。
  • PostgreSQL:高性能的關係型數據庫,支持複雜查詢和數據完整性。

安裝數據庫

以 MySQL 為例

以下是安裝 MySQL 的步驟:

1. 下載 MySQL 安裝包:
   前往 MySQL 官方網站下載適合您操作系統的安裝包。

2. 安裝 MySQL:
   按照安裝向導的指示進行安裝,並設置 root 密碼。

3. 啟動 MySQL 服務:
   在命令行中輸入以下命令啟動 MySQL 服務:
   sudo service mysql start

建立數據庫

安裝完成後,您可以使用以下命令來建立一個新的數據庫:

mysql -u root -p
CREATE DATABASE my_database;

在這裡,您需要輸入之前設置的 root 密碼。成功執行後,您將看到一條確認消息,表示數據庫已成功創建。

建立數據表

接下來,您可以在新創建的數據庫中建立數據表。以下是一個簡單的示例:

USE my_database;

CREATE TABLE users (
    id INT AUTO_INCREMENT PRIMARY KEY,
    name VARCHAR(100) NOT NULL,
    email VARCHAR(100) NOT NULL UNIQUE
);

這段代碼將創建一個名為 “users” 的數據表,包含三個字段:id、name 和 email。

插入數據

數據表建立後,您可以插入數據:

INSERT INTO users (name, email) VALUES ('John Doe', 'john@example.com');

這條命令將一條新記錄插入到 “users” 表中。

查詢數據

最後,您可以使用 SELECT 語句查詢數據:

SELECT * FROM users;

這將返回 “users” 表中的所有記錄。

總結

建立單機數據庫是一個相對簡單的過程,無論您是使用 MySQL、SQLite 還是 PostgreSQL,都可以通過上述步驟輕鬆完成。這不僅有助於開發和測試,還能讓您更好地理解數據庫的運作方式。如果您需要更高效的數據管理解決方案,可以考慮使用 香港VPS 來部署您的數據庫,享受更好的性能和穩定性。